Ľubomír Luhový
Ľubomír Luhový (born 31 March 1967) is a Slovak former football player and manager. He is former sporting director of Třinec. In his club career he played mostly for FK Inter Bratislava.
Club career
Luhový played for FC Martigues in the French Ligue 2 during the 1991–92 season.
International career
Luhový made two appearances for the Czechoslovakia national team. He also made nine appearances for the Slovakia national team.
Managerial career
Luhový started as manager of FC Nitra and Fotbal Třinec in the Czech 2. Liga on 7 October 2010. He was replaced as manager in April 2012, with Třinec 13th in the table. However Luhový stayed on at the club in a new role, as sporting director.
